Sustainable development is the development that meets the needs of the present without compromising the ability of future generations to meet their own needs (UN Brundtland Commission).
So, from the definition the first advantage is that it allows the next generation of people to have access to quality life. Second is that it makes life meaningful and worth living for us. Imagine if we cab reduce the number of greenhouse gases, this will lessen the effect on the ozone layer. Maybe then we will have to face less heat globally. With sustainable development, we can feed a hungry world, we can sustain and save quality aquatic floral and fauna life.
Sustainable development also teaches is to be responsible. Don't throw plasitcs in the ocean, don't burn openly, don't throw wastes in drsinages. All this means we're taking charge of our lives.
Sustainable also helps us cut down cost and reduce waste. You don't buy what you don't need. You don't order for an amount of food you can't exhaust. You wouldn't waste so much as 40% of your farm produce because you will be interested in ways to reduce this. You will spend less and generate less waste. Even your waste won't be waste at a point. Sustinable Development means development that take place without damaging the environment. It meets the needs of present without compromising the needs of future generations. Therefore, resources should be utilised judiciously.
